Steadfast carves up Coverforce divisions
Coverforce Insurance Brokers will be sold to GSA; its network will go to CBN and its strata portfolio will be transferred to BCB Group.

AUB Group’s exclusivity period with EQT for takeover extended by 2 weeks
AUB had announced last week that it received a confidential and non-binding indicative proposal to acquire 100% of AUB by way of a scheme of arrangement for AU$45 (US$29.5) per share.
